How Champagne is made: Traditional method + Crémant alternative guide
March 4, 2025
Champagne is synonymous with celebration and luxury, but you don't have to break the bank for top-quality sparkling wine. Enter Crémant, a French sparkling wine made using the exact same traditional method as Champagne but from outside the prestigious region. Here's why Crémant is the ultimate insider's choice for quality-conscious wine lovers.

Dom Pérignon Abbey grounds in Champagne France showing historic monastery and vineyard estate
December 22, 2024
It's almost impossible to think of Champagne without thinking of Dom Pérignon. These French winemakers have been delivering some of the world's most collectible wines for over a century, releasing only 48 vintages in that time. This is where Dom Pérignon stands apart: if the quality isn't perfect, they simply don't bottle it.

Rockford Vineyard historic stone buildings in Barossa Valley showing traditional Australian winery architecture
December 22, 2024
Rockford isn't just a winery - it's a living time capsule born from discarded vineyard tools and a bold vision to celebrate the Barossa Valley's past. When Robert O'Callaghan founded Rockford in 1984, he chose forgotten equipment and century-old vines while others rushed toward modernity, creating Australia's most revered traditional wines.
